Commit Graph

19479 Commits

Author SHA1 Message Date
rusefillc 8449b5ad01 Merge branch 'master' of https://github.com/rusefi/rusefi into master 2023-08-27 09:31:25 -04:00
Matthew Kennedy 46cf473015 rename 2023-08-27 09:31:19 -04:00
Matthew Kennedy 2c5a6588e9 no need to check 2023-08-27 09:30:41 -04:00
Andrey 13bbb72264 null terminate USB strings 2023-08-27 09:30:33 -04:00
GitHub gen-configs Action 3099d4d845 Auto-generated configs and docs 2023-08-27 13:25:20 +00:00
rusefillc 6fa7e64080 Merge branch 'master' of https://github.com/rusefi/rusefi into master 2023-08-27 09:21:42 -04:00
GitHub gen-configs Action 5cc2fe7043 Auto-generated configs and docs 2023-08-27 13:11:47 +00:00
Matthew Kennedy 05b3986ef3 changelog 2023-08-27 09:10:35 -04:00
Matthew Kennedy 11bd7504d2 add MSM IAT preset 2023-08-27 09:09:57 -04:00
Matthew Kennedy 053311fc23 default prime pulse 2023-08-27 09:09:38 -04:00
Matthew Kennedy c7a183db49 this button isn't useful as it just bricks the ECU 2023-08-27 09:08:08 -04:00
rusefi 8f0ff58ee7 https://github.com/rusefi/rusefi/issues/5511
only:alphax-2chan
2023-08-26 22:29:31 -04:00
GitHub gen-configs Action ba82a004be Auto-generated configs and docs 2023-08-27 02:19:47 +00:00
rusefi 70035fe579 https://github.com/rusefi/rusefi/issues/5511
only:alphax_2chan
2023-08-26 22:15:47 -04:00
rusefi a872d8067d https://github.com/rusefi/rusefi/issues/5511
only:alphax_2chan
2023-08-26 22:12:52 -04:00
GitHub set-date Action f4e0acf76d Update date 2023-08-27 00:44:51 +00:00
GitHub gen-configs Action 104bdd8980 Auto-generated configs and docs 2023-08-26 20:02:40 +00:00
Andreika 46ded5cbcb
Move cyclic_buffer.h and fifo_buffer.h to libfirmware (#5544)
* Move cyclic_buffer.h and fifo_buffer.h to libfirmware

* move cyclic_buffer.h and fifo_buffer.h to containers dir
2023-08-26 15:59:45 -04:00
GitHub set-date Action e1ab519a71 Update date 2023-08-26 00:41:11 +00:00
rusefillc 6103b4f723 Mitsubishi 4G69 Cam pattern fix #5541 2023-08-25 11:33:36 -04:00
Andrey c5966f4fee 4G69 Cam pattern #5541 2023-08-25 11:00:35 -04:00
Andrey 3ca310c354 saving 20 bytes for 8chan7 2023-08-25 10:34:57 -04:00
GitHub gen-configs Action a910adae94 Auto-generated configs and docs 2023-08-25 05:13:10 +00:00
Andrey 4fbccca850 4G69 Cam pattern #5541 2023-08-25 01:10:08 -04:00
GitHub gen-configs Action 43fbbef224 Auto-generated configs and docs 2023-08-25 02:53:25 +00:00
Andrey 49a270e3a3 4G69 Cam pattern #5541 2023-08-24 22:50:16 -04:00
GitHub set-date Action 418902c039 Update date 2023-08-25 00:45:59 +00:00
GitHub gen-configs Action 0af577c640 Auto-generated configs and docs 2023-08-24 22:36:50 +00:00
rusefillc 57a3c11dd6 MRE can do dual hall 2023-08-24 18:33:03 -04:00
GitHub gen-configs Action f3fff897e6 Auto-generated configs and docs 2023-08-24 20:52:40 +00:00
rusefillc aa713e4768 EGO sensor type dropdown is broken, all settings the same #553 2023-08-24 16:49:05 -04:00
rusefillc 2496c8ba35 dead 2023-08-24 16:34:06 -04:00
rusefillc 64cc46d8ec AEM WBO EGO preset 2023-08-24 16:29:35 -04:00
Andreika f76ae88aff
CAN bench: set engine type command (#5538)
* CAN_BENCH_SET_ENGINE_TYPE

* fir setPin()

* update libfirmware
2023-08-24 09:48:30 -04:00
rusefillc fc5c9542c5
helping cypress (#5537)
* helping cypress

* helping cypress
2023-08-24 00:35:13 -04:00
GitHub gen-configs Action 2f1c02d956 Auto-generated configs and docs 2023-08-24 03:50:34 +00:00
rusefi 41bb19fdf8 *_STIM_QC 2023-08-23 23:47:32 -04:00
rusefi 0b28b5c86b fresh 2023-08-23 23:46:55 -04:00
GitHub gen-configs Action fdfa6c6c8e Auto-generated configs and docs 2023-08-24 02:00:20 +00:00
rusefi 4f192b5c84 proteusStimQc
only:proteus_f7
2023-08-23 21:57:08 -04:00
GitHub set-date Action 93bfbecea3 Update date 2023-08-23 00:37:26 +00:00
rusefillc fd740a5a63 broadcast button toggle counter #5514
only:fancy boolean with counter
2023-08-22 15:04:39 -04:00
rusefillc 5f714480c6 broadcast button toggle counter #5514
only:fancy boolean with counter
2023-08-22 14:57:14 -04:00
rusefillc a041eb55f3 broadcast button toggle counter #5514
only:fancy boolen with counter
2023-08-22 14:49:28 -04:00
rusefillc 3c8cd08c61 broadcast button toggle counter #5514
only:fancy boolen with counter
2023-08-22 14:37:17 -04:00
GitHub gen-configs Action 5e52aa0ed0 Auto-generated configs and docs 2023-08-22 18:32:00 +00:00
rusefillc 21fb17e2b5 broadcast button toggle counter #5514
only:changing proper lines
2023-08-22 14:26:47 -04:00
GitHub gen-configs Action 03e0ada1a9 Auto-generated configs and docs 2023-08-22 18:21:31 +00:00
rusefillc 7bbf972c83 broadcast button toggle counter #5514 2023-08-22 14:16:30 -04:00
Andreika 073f6cfbb0
fix mixed up CLT & IAT in the bench_test_raw_analog CAN packet https://github.com/rusefi/rusefi-hardware/issues/228 (#5533) 2023-08-22 08:51:12 -04:00
GitHub gen-configs Action f50cc7743c Auto-generated configs and docs 2023-08-22 04:37:56 +00:00
rusefi 6d4a4a6449 PROTEUS_STIM_QC 2023-08-22 00:34:45 -04:00
GitHub gen-configs Action 267abc22e9 Auto-generated configs and docs 2023-08-22 03:25:30 +00:00
rusefillc 787bba32bd
extracting stm32 pins (#5530) 2023-08-21 23:09:52 -04:00
rusefi b785ed1019 PinRepository encapsulation 2023-08-21 23:09:30 -04:00
rusefi 6b5e42a7a6 let's admit it we are using C++ syntax 2023-08-21 22:26:09 -04:00
GitHub gen-configs Action ccc08fe7db Auto-generated configs and docs 2023-08-22 00:16:26 +00:00
rusefillc 93f7077f92
Dup2 (#5528)
* reducing code duplication around ADC enums

* reducing code duplication around ADC enums
2023-08-21 20:06:54 -04:00
rusefi 9adc323fec CAN bench test: broadcast raw analog values #5437 2023-08-21 19:59:51 -04:00
rusefi dded7f2926 engine_type_e 16 bits should do it 2023-08-21 19:28:24 -04:00
rusefi fb89607ff3 fresh lib 2023-08-21 19:28:05 -04:00
GitHub gen-configs Action cb91d70bd6 Auto-generated configs and docs 2023-08-21 23:14:01 +00:00
rusefillc 2cfd8e1be9 engine_type_e 16 bits should do it 2023-08-21 19:04:29 -04:00
GitHub gen-configs Action fc51615238 Auto-generated configs and docs 2023-08-21 22:39:50 +00:00
rusefillc 16e1cb946e
reducing code duplication (#5527)
* reducing code duplication

* reducing code duplication
2023-08-21 18:36:59 -04:00
rusefillc f74e6d2261 spelling 2023-08-21 15:39:53 -04:00
GitHub gen-configs Action 690f06b523 Auto-generated configs and docs 2023-08-21 19:01:13 +00:00
rusefillc 8773efc24b dead CAN_ECU_HW_META 2023-08-21 14:56:28 -04:00
rusefillc cf7944cd78 CAN side of automated testing fix #4630
closing simply because we have too many tickets
2023-08-21 00:40:36 -04:00
rusefi e8c45a2e7d refactoring: reducing code duplication. Also, do we even care for critical error codes?! 2023-08-20 22:23:44 -04:00
rusefi 54797ab559 refactoring: reducing code duplication. Also, do we even care for critical error codes?! 2023-08-20 22:05:19 -04:00
rusefi dbfbe3f980 bench_test CAN packets do not use proper IDs #5525 2023-08-20 21:56:01 -04:00
rusefi acbe956a05 Merge branch 'master' of https://github.com/rusefi/rusefi 2023-08-20 21:41:49 -04:00
rusefi 80e52f5898 bench_test CAN packets do not use proper IDs #5525
only:hw
2023-08-20 21:41:25 -04:00
GitHub gen-configs Action 7ad0c354f3 Auto-generated configs and docs 2023-08-21 01:38:16 +00:00
rusefi d08fbc2878 bench_test CAN packets do not use proper IDs #5525 2023-08-20 21:35:04 -04:00
rusefi 398f885a72 Merge branch 'master' of https://github.com/rusefi/rusefi 2023-08-20 21:26:59 -04:00
rusefi 983f84ce0f bench_test CAN packets do not use proper IDs #5525 2023-08-20 21:26:33 -04:00
GitHub set-date Action ca80bbea3f Update date 2023-08-21 00:41:03 +00:00
rusefillc b2c8e06d1c broadcast button toggle counter #5514 2023-08-20 17:27:41 -04:00
rusefillc 33ea4e56eb fresh 2023-08-20 16:49:42 -04:00
GitHub gen-configs Action ed5dbd72f2 Auto-generated configs and docs 2023-08-20 02:28:25 +00:00
rusefi 1802f707bd only:hellen-honda-k 2023-08-19 22:25:10 -04:00
GitHub gen-configs Action 09c22da319 Auto-generated configs and docs 2023-08-20 01:30:45 +00:00
GitHub set-date Action 82d8e24f32 Update date 2023-08-20 00:44:12 +00:00
GitHub gen-configs Action 34fc11b780 Auto-generated configs and docs 2023-08-19 19:08:19 +00:00
Andreika c41934b2b2
broadcast vehicleSpeedSensor.eventCounter #5519 (#5522) 2023-08-19 15:04:46 -04:00
GitHub set-date Action 13e4804e69 Update date 2023-08-19 00:43:37 +00:00
Andreika 84c6d4cde6
More universal Board-ID for bench test (#5518)
* add STATIC_BOARD_ID defines to get Board-ID more universal

* add getBoardId()

* broadcast BENCH_TEST_BOARD_STATUS via CAN

* add guards for sendBoardStatus()
2023-08-18 18:41:17 -04:00
GitHub gen-configs Action f2fce491b9 Auto-generated configs and docs 2023-08-18 04:30:26 +00:00
rusefi 0190017e71 Move Knock Settings from Controller to Ignition
fix #5516
2023-08-18 00:26:43 -04:00
rusefi 1fc8952f52 fuelBenchMode
only:proteus_f7
2023-08-18 00:25:49 -04:00
rusefi e5293c1ae6 fuelBenchMode
only:proteus_f7
2023-08-18 00:09:04 -04:00
rusefi e810068e7e everyone likes proteus 2023-08-18 00:03:28 -04:00
GitHub set-date Action 5fe8688eae Update date 2023-08-18 00:47:29 +00:00
GitHub gen-configs Action fd4e910c3f Auto-generated configs and docs 2023-08-17 23:47:22 +00:00
rusefillc 555ffd42fb only:112 2023-08-17 19:44:15 -04:00
rusefillc 801a0888e0 v12 2023-08-17 12:51:36 -04:00
rusefillc a10b619a2f can_rx: dead 2023-08-17 11:53:00 -04:00
rusefillc e4fa019029 can_rx: dead 2023-08-17 08:25:45 -04:00
GitHub gen-configs Action 00e2136288 Auto-generated configs and docs 2023-08-17 11:58:33 +00:00
rusefillc e52f76a178 "Single Tooth" renamed to "Half Moon", more proper "Single Tooth" crank trigger as a new trigger #5488 2023-08-17 07:52:51 -04:00
GitHub gen-configs Action ed8b3fdb13 Auto-generated configs and docs 2023-08-17 01:23:03 +00:00
GitHub set-date Action 8e39eb075b Update date 2023-08-16 00:42:58 +00:00
Andrey ee83fea7e0 Renault F 60-2-2 trigger wheel fix #5513 2023-08-15 12:50:54 -04:00
Andrey 1774a75732 docs & extracing constant 2023-08-15 12:25:53 -04:00
GitHub gen-configs Action 37b2f74f17 Auto-generated configs and docs 2023-08-15 12:55:35 +00:00
rusefillc 8ddb59db32 Renault F3R trigger #5513 2023-08-15 08:49:20 -04:00
GitHub gen-configs Action 55f4dee098 Auto-generated configs and docs 2023-08-15 12:45:50 +00:00
GitHub set-date Action cb247cf3b4 Update date 2023-08-15 00:45:11 +00:00
Andreika e4a4042169
CAN bench test: broadcast raw analog values #5437 (#5512) 2023-08-14 16:28:14 -04:00
GitHub set-date Action bdb0a0755d Update date 2023-08-14 00:51:37 +00:00
GitHub gen-configs Action f757e8d3b5 Auto-generated configs and docs 2023-08-14 00:00:14 +00:00
rusefi 5ca1736298 v12 2023-08-13 19:57:15 -04:00
rusefillc 3696494d74 progress 2023-08-13 18:32:12 -04:00
rusefillc 7fa649efd3 docs PCF8575 and code style 2023-08-13 12:33:00 -04:00
Andreika c303a8cfd9
CAN bench test: broadcast event counters #5436 (#5510)
* CAN bench test: broadcast event counters #5436

* update libfirmware

* update libfirmware

* Broadcast eventcnts every 100ms

* Add EFI_SHAFT_POSITION_INPUT guards
2023-08-13 10:30:46 -04:00
GitHub set-date Action e1e8ee0929 Update date 2023-08-13 00:43:39 +00:00
GitHub gen-configs Action 67088213db Auto-generated configs and docs 2023-08-12 23:36:47 +00:00
rusefi 13faddd7c7 Honda BCM & random
only:small-can-board
2023-08-12 19:33:17 -04:00
GitHub gen-configs Action 0d1c64e184 Auto-generated configs and docs 2023-08-12 22:49:25 +00:00
rusefi 0d87a0bc41 Honda BCM & random
only:small-can-board
2023-08-12 18:46:07 -04:00
GitHub gen-configs Action 592502b9e1 Auto-generated configs and docs 2023-08-12 22:44:13 +00:00
rusefi ceb7d36358 hmm?
only:alphax-2chan
2023-08-12 18:41:08 -04:00
GitHub gen-configs Action 83a0997ad8 Auto-generated configs and docs 2023-08-12 22:10:06 +00:00
rusefi ad21014376 Lua: do not sleep while TS is talking
only:small-can-board
2023-08-12 18:06:52 -04:00
GitHub set-date Action 5001d93273 Update date 2023-08-12 00:43:55 +00:00
Andrey G 9a9495f0fb
Pvs analysis (#5509)
* The 'chip->drv_state' variable is assigned values twice successively.

Found with PVS-Studio

* variable is assigned to itself

Found with PVS-Studio

---------

Co-authored-by: Andrey Gusakov <andrey.gusakov@cogentembedded.com>
2023-08-11 11:21:43 -04:00
GitHub gen-configs Action ce79795d46 Auto-generated configs and docs 2023-08-11 05:59:22 +00:00
rusefillc c3b1ef1164 genesis coupe: Add K54 to Analog Inputs fix #5507 2023-08-11 01:56:10 -04:00
GitHub gen-configs Action 541ecf3f7f Auto-generated configs and docs 2023-08-11 03:20:11 +00:00
rusefi 063495a870 Specific GM throttle TPS has issues #5506 2023-08-10 23:16:42 -04:00
GitHub set-date Action 28f631d1e2 Update date 2023-08-11 00:42:45 +00:00
GitHub gen-configs Action 08e12cd318 Auto-generated configs and docs 2023-08-10 07:02:59 +00:00
rusefillc d71f9600ad SBC 2023-08-10 02:59:50 -04:00
GitHub set-date Action 62ebb6a206 Update date 2023-08-10 00:41:26 +00:00
rusefillc 4d076b8211 only:SBC 2023-08-09 17:22:37 -04:00
rusefillc 6e50ebcac2 only:SBC 2023-08-09 15:14:01 -04:00
rusefillc 7fa5cb2d65 just need kinetis to compile
only:kinetis
2023-08-09 15:14:01 -04:00
GitHub gen-configs Action b848156886 Auto-generated configs and docs 2023-08-09 09:52:08 +00:00
rusefillc 17026dbb3d MAP Sync not working #5503
additional data points
2023-08-09 05:49:06 -04:00
rusefillc efcb45a94c Revert "only:alphax_4chan"
This reverts commit baaec6ff32.
2023-08-09 05:47:56 -04:00
GitHub gen-configs Action f889aa76b6 Auto-generated configs and docs 2023-08-09 09:41:01 +00:00
rusefillc 1a7d9b0f43 MAP Sync not working #5503
additional data points
2023-08-09 05:35:14 -04:00
GitHub gen-configs Action fbca8d0481 Auto-generated configs and docs 2023-08-09 09:01:25 +00:00
Andrey 1486b6709a "rpmAcceleration" in TS doesn't go lower than 0 fix #5504 2023-08-09 04:57:59 -04:00
rusefillc 9f4647a99f CLI encapsulation preparing for libfirmware move 2023-08-08 23:53:59 -04:00
rusefillc 515122ea74 poor thing out of flash again :( 2023-08-08 23:50:20 -04:00
rusefillc 795a76638c EFI_TUNER_STUDIO guard fix 2023-08-08 23:50:20 -04:00
rusefillc b21455e178 CLI encapsulation preparing for libfirmware move 2023-08-08 23:02:20 -04:00